The moon has a profound effect on the tides. The gravitational pull of the moon creates two tidal bulges in the earth’s oceans- one on the side of the earth facing the moon, and one on the opposite side. WebWhen the Moon is at first quarter or third quarter, the Sun, Earth, and Moon form an "L" shape, and the tidal bulges of the Moon and the Sun make the shape of a plus sign (+). This creates a neap tide. Neap tides have a … WebThe relative distances and positions of the sun, moon and Earth all affect the size and magnitude of the Earth’s two tidal bulges. At a smaller scale, the magnitude of tides can be strongly influenced by the shape of the shoreline.
